What a strong delivery driver resume needs
- A summary naming your delivery type (local, last-mile) and an on-time or safety metric.
- A skills section with safe driving, route navigation, and package handling.
- Bullets with numbers — stops per day, on-time rate, accident-free years, damage rate.
- A valid license and clean record; single-column, standard-heading layout.
Example bullet points
- Completed 120+ stops per day with a 99% on-time delivery rate.
- Maintained a spotless driving record over 3 years and zero preventable accidents.
- Handled packages carefully, keeping damage claims under 0.5%.
